Part of the Mercier Bridge will be closed all weekend, while those using the Bonaventure Expressway can expect detours if travelling at night.

One lane in each direction of the Mercier shuts down at 10 p.m. Friday and is scheduled to re-open at 5 a.m. Monday June 1.

Construction crews will be preparing the bridge to be resurfaced later this year.

Meanwhile work will be taking place Saturday and Sunday night at the downtown Montreal end of the Bonaventure Expressway.

From 10:30 pm. Saturday until 9 a.m. Sunday, and again from 8:30 p.m. Sunday until 5 a.m. Monday, crews will be working on the highway between Exit 2 and downtown Montreal. Crews will be doing annual maintenance on the raised section of the expressway, and one lane in each direction will remain closed after this weekend.

Other work planned for the other end of the Bonaventure this weekend on Clement Bridge toward Nuns' Island, has been postponed because of the storms in the forecast.

"That work is on the membrane, and we cannot do it when it is wet," said Anne-Marie Braconnier, a spokesperson for the Jacques Cartier and Champlain Bridges Corporation.
